Drawing - Parent and projection view

Hi all,

 

I am new to creo I have a query on the drawing of view. I have projected a view from a parent view and have created a lot of dimensions. Now I just want to delete the parent view or make the projected view as a parent. Is there a way to do this? This is because if I delete the parent view then the projected view also gets deleted along with it.

@NareshR 

Select the projected view, right mouse click and edit the properties of the view, in the view type category, change Projection to General.

That "disconnects" the view from it's parent.

  1. In creo, in general, in 99.999% of cases, you DON NOT create dimensions on the drawing - you show dimensions from the model  (annotate tab, show annotations)
    1. dimensions are taken from sketches, and other features - extrudes, revolves, etc.
  2. the model drives drawing - this is one way
  3. a view you have described is good to create in the model through, view manager -> orient
    1. you align it by planes, surfaces, etc.,
    2. and then create dimensions if those are needed - and what is stated in pint 1a is not enough
  4. in your case - if you can allow yourself to be lazy, just move the parent/general view from the format area, and next time do it correctly
